Nassir Navab Receives 2025 IEEE EMBS Technical Achievement Award

Awarded at This Year’s EMBC Conference

Our PI Nassir Navab has received the 2025 IEEE EMBS Technical Achievement Award.

He was recognized “for pioneering roles in the establishment of the medical augmented reality, surgical data science, and robotic imaging fields.”

The award, presented annually by the IEEE Engineering in Medicine and Biology Society (EMBS), honors individuals for outstanding achievements and innovations in the field of biomedical engineering.
